Jesus Christ Sculpture by Veronica Terrillion, Easter 2024

Jesus sculpture by Veronica Terrillion, Croghan, NY.  photo by Gary Walts

 It is Easter Sunday 2024. A couple months ago I snapped this photo of Jesus as sculpted by the late folk artist Veronica Terrillion, Croghan, NY. It its part of her "Woman Made Garden" that has fallen into a certain amount of neglect. Many years ago I met with her a number of times. Once was to photograph Her and her artwork for Adirondack Life Magazine.  Much of her work is now gone and what remains is overgrown and showing the wear of time and weather. However, it still remains inspiring and memorable.

Jesus Sculpture by Veronica Terrillion Croghan NY

I present here a photo I snapped on March 7, 2024. It is a cement sculpture of Jesus Christ created by Veronica Terrillion. t is at the home she built in Croghan, NY. Trrillion did in 2003. Not a lot remains of her "woman made garden". What is left is weathered but still vibrant and beautiful. 
Jesus and some animals. Cement sculpture created by Veronica Terrillion on an island in a pond at here home in Croghan, NY.  photo by Gary Walts
